1. Halloween (1978)

Halloween (1978)
No Halloween list is complete without the original halloween movie. Directed by John Carpenter, this classic introduced the world to Michael Myers, a relentless killer whose presence alone creates tension and fear. Its iconic theme music still sends chills to horror fans everywhere.
Why it’s a must-watch:
-
One of the first true slasher horror movies
-
Legendary suspense and minimalistic terror
-
Perfect for both first-time viewers and horror enthusiasts
2. The Exorcist (1973)

The Exorcist (1973)
A timeless scary movie, The Exorcist is famous for its demonic possession story. The film’s combination of psychological horror and shocking visuals has made it a staple of Halloween nights.
Why it’s a must-watch:
-
Groundbreaking special effects for its time
-
Intensely suspenseful storytelling
-
Classic example of supernatural horror movies
3. A Nightmare on Elm Street (1984)

A Nightmare on Elm Street (1984)
Freddy Krueger, with his burned face and bladed glove, is one of the most iconic villains in halloween movies history. This slasher horror movie brings terror through dreams, making viewers question the safety of sleep itself.
Why it’s a must-watch:
-
Innovative premise blending dreams and reality
-
Iconic villain that changed horror cinema
-
Perfect for fans of suspenseful and creative scares
4. Hereditary (2018)

Hereditary (2018)
Modern horror enthusiasts can’t miss Hereditary, a scary movie known for its psychological intensity. This film explores grief, trauma, and family secrets, creating a creeping sense of dread that lingers long after the credits roll.
Why it’s a must-watch:
-
Deep psychological horror
-
Unsettling atmosphere and shocking twists
-
Shows that halloween movies can be both smart and terrifying

8. The Shining (1980)

The Shining (1980)
Stanley Kubrick’s The Shining is a psychological horror movie masterpiece. Jack Nicholson’s descent into madness and the eerie Overlook Hotel have cemented this film as a classic Halloween essential.
Why it’s a must-watch:
-
Perfect blend of psychological terror and supernatural elements
-
Iconic lines and scenes still referenced today
-
One of the greatest halloween movies ever made
